Our review

Scale and regional reach

SportsBroker operates internationally but maintains a relatively small footprint in the global market. Our data indicates a website traffic rank of 1015, with approximately 196 daily visits, suggesting it serves a niche audience rather than a mass-market demographic.

Regulation and account basics

The brand is regulated under a Malta licence, which provides a level of oversight for international users. Account management is currently limited in terms of variety; the platform supports the British Pound as its currency, and the service is provided exclusively in English.

Specialised sports and betting model

The primary focus here is atypical betting, which deviates from standard fixed-odds markets. The sports coverage is currently restricted to two major categories:

  • Soccer
  • American football

Because of its unique betting structure and specific regional rules, you should check the operator site for full terms and KYC requirements before signing up.
